Job Description
Ameriprise Financial is looking to add a Legal Affairs Manager to the team! The individual in this position will focus primarily on supporting the Columbia Threadneedle Investments registered investment companies. Under the direction of an attorney, responsible for performing on-going legal and regulatory related activities with respect to the registered investment companies. Coordinates the creation, updating, and filing of registration statement post-effective amendments containing prospectuses and statements of additional information (SAIs) (including annual updates and supplements thereto) and other disclosure documents required by the Investment Company Act of 1940 ("1940 Act"), Securities Act of 1933 and the Securities Exchange Act of 1934. Solicits and coordinates input to disclosure documents from business lines (including product, marketing, fund administration, compliance and investment personnel), outside counsel and outside accountants.
